Introducing the WSCM 2026 Choirs: The Shanghai Youth Choir, China
Published: Mar 31,2026

The China Welfare Institute Children’s Palace Little Companion Art Troupe Choir was founded on 1 June 1955 by Soong Ching Ling and is one of the leading youth choirs in Shanghai. The choir has performed at major events such as the APEC Meeting, Shanghai World Expo, and the CICA Summit, and works closely with groups like the Shanghai Symphony Orchestra and Shanghai Opera House, as well as renowned musicians including Plácido Domingo and Tan Dun.

In 2012, the Shanghai Youth Choir (SYC) was established under the Shanghai Municipal Education Commission and is known as a “golden cradle of singers.” Its federation now includes over 300 member choirs, helping raise the overall standard of choral education in Shanghai. The choir has collaborated with distinguished conductors and won multiple international awards, including top prizes at the Singing World, Singapore International Choir Competition, Béla Bartók International Choir Competition, and the 13th World Choir Games in 2024.
